this is a good price. free shipping with total order of $50 or more.

you shouldn't have to pay more than $0.25/foot if you have a computer and little time to research.....

but your 100-foot order may have a seam in it, and you don't want a weak seam in your slackline. you could call and/or email in advance of your order to make certain you'll get a full length of webbing with no seam.

I recieved my webbing today, they were really quick about it.

It never ceases to amaze me how many types and weaves there are of nylon webbing. This is by far the smallest/tightest (and slickest) weave of tubular nylon webbing I've seen, even though I've used Bluewater webbing before. Nothing wrong with it at all, just different than what I'm used to.
